Securing Your Enterprise Assets
In today's interconnected world, businesses of all sizes are facing increasing threats to their critical information. Implementing robust information security best practices is essential for safeguarding sensitive data and ensuring business continuity. A strong defense framework should encompass a multi-layered approach, including:
- Implementing stringent access control measures to restrict unauthorized access to systems and data.
- Executing regular security assessments and vulnerability scans to identify potential weaknesses.
- Instructing employees on best practices for data handling.
- Leveraging strong passwords, multi-factor authentication, and encryption to protect sensitive information.
- Implementing a comprehensive disaster recovery plan to ensure business continuity in the event of a security breach.
By adhering to these best practices, companies can significantly reduce their risk of security incidents and protect their valuable assets.

Zero Trust Architecture : Securing Access and Data in the Modern Enterprise
In today's dynamic enterprise landscape, securing access to valuable data has become more difficult than ever. Traditional security models often rely on perimeter-based gateways, which can be quickly breached by advanced attackers. This is where Zero get more info Trust Architecture comes into play, providing a robust and adaptable framework for securing access and data in the modern enterprise.
Zero Trust operates on the fundamental principle of "never trust, always verify." It assumes that no user, device, or application can be inherently trusted, regardless of its position. This means that every request for access to resources is rigorously scrutinized and authenticated.
- Adopting Zero Trust requires a multifaceted approach that includes implementing multi-factor authentication, enforcing strict permission levels, and leveraging proactive threat intelligence to identify and mitigate potential threats.
- Furthermore, Zero Trust emphasizes the importance of data segmentation, which involves dividing sensitive data into separate compartments based on their classification. This helps to minimize the impact of a potential breach by limiting the attacker's access to primary resources.
By adopting a Zero Trust Architecture, enterprises can significantly strengthen their security posture, protect against evolving threats, and build a more resilient and trustworthy digital environment.
